Types of Ovulation Kits and Their Price Points
Okay, so let's break down the different types of ovulation kits you'll encounter online and what you can generally expect to pay for them. Knowing your options is half the battle when it comes to managing your budget and choosing the right kit for your needs.
Basic Ovulation Test Strips
These are your no-frills, budget-friendly options. These strips measure the level of luteinizing hormone (LH) in your urine. A surge in LH typically indicates that ovulation is about to occur. You pee in a cup, dip the strip, and wait a few minutes for the result. Simple, right? The beauty of these strips is their affordability. You can often find packs of 25 to 50 strips for around $10 to $25. This makes them a great option if you're testing frequently or for multiple cycles. However, keep in mind that interpreting the results can sometimes be a bit tricky. You'll need to compare the test line to the control line to determine if you've detected an LH surge. Some people find this process subjective, which can lead to uncertainty.
Digital Ovulation Kits
For those who prefer a more clear-cut answer, digital ovulation kits are the way to go. These kits also measure LH levels, but they come with a digital reader that displays the results as either a positive or negative. No more squinting at lines! This ease of use comes at a slightly higher price point. A digital ovulation kit typically costs between $20 and $50, and this usually includes a set number of test strips (often around 10 to 20). Once you run out of strips, you'll need to buy refills. While the initial investment is higher than basic test strips, many users find the convenience and accuracy worth the extra cost. The digital display eliminates any ambiguity, giving you peace of mind that you're interpreting the results correctly.
Advanced Digital Ovulation Kits
If you want to take your ovulation tracking to the next level, advanced digital kits are the crème de la crème. These kits not only track LH levels but also monitor estrogen levels. By tracking both hormones, these kits can identify a wider fertile window, giving you more opportunities to conceive. The science behind this is that estrogen levels rise in the days leading up to ovulation, while the LH surge indicates that ovulation is imminent. By knowing when your estrogen levels start to rise, you can start trying to conceive sooner, potentially increasing your chances of success. As you might expect, these advanced kits come with a premium price tag. They can range from $50 to $80 or even more, depending on the brand and features. The refills for these kits are also more expensive than those for basic digital kits. However, if you have irregular cycles or want the most comprehensive information possible, an advanced digital kit might be a worthwhile investment.
Saliva Ovulation Microscopes
Now, here's a slightly different approach: saliva ovulation microscopes. Instead of testing urine, these devices allow you to check your saliva for ferning patterns, which appear when estrogen levels rise. You simply place a drop of saliva on the microscope slide, let it dry, and then examine it under the lens. If you see a fern-like pattern, it indicates that you're approaching ovulation. The main advantage of these microscopes is that they're reusable. You buy the microscope once (usually for around $20 to $50), and then you can use it for as many cycles as you like. No need to keep buying test strips! However, learning to interpret the results can take some practice. The ferning patterns can be subtle, and it might take a few cycles to become confident in your ability to identify them accurately. Additionally, factors like eating, drinking, or brushing your teeth can affect the results, so it's important to follow the instructions carefully.

Brand Reputation and Reliability
Just like with any product, brand reputation plays a significant role in pricing. Well-established brands with a long history of accuracy and reliability tend to charge more for their ovulation kits. These brands have often invested heavily in research and development to ensure their products are as accurate and user-friendly as possible. Think of brands like Clearblue or First Response. They've built a strong reputation over the years, and consumers are often willing to pay a premium for the peace of mind that comes with using a trusted brand. On the other hand, lesser-known or generic brands may offer lower prices, but you might sacrifice some accuracy or reliability. It's always a good idea to read reviews and do some research before opting for a cheaper brand to make sure you're not compromising on quality.
